首页 > 常见问题 > 正文

nfapi.dll是什么

下次还敢
发布: 2024-08-01 23:22:19
原创
564人浏览过

nfapi.dll 是一个 windows 系统文件,全称是 network filter api dll。它并非一个独立运行的程序,而是 windows 网络堆栈的一部分,为网络过滤器驱动程序提供了一个接口。 简单来说,它就像一个中转站,允许其他程序(例如防火墙、vpn 软件等)监控和修改网络数据包。

nfapi.dll是什么

理解 nfapi.dll 的关键在于认识到它本身并不执行任何具体的网络功能,而是提供了一种机制,让其他程序能够介入网络通信过程。 我曾经遇到过一个案例,一位朋友的电脑因为恶意软件感染,导致网络连接异常缓慢。 经过排查,发现一个恶意程序正通过 nfapi.dll 劫持网络数据包,从而窃取信息并减缓网络速度。 最终,我们通过删除恶意程序并重新启动系统解决了这个问题。这说明,nfapi.dll 本身并没有问题,问题在于利用它的程序。

另一个例子,我协助一位开发人员调试一个新的网络监控工具。 这个工具需要监控所有进出电脑的网络流量,而实现这一功能的关键就在于正确地使用 nfapi.dll 提供的接口。 在调试过程中,我们发现一个细节问题:程序没有正确处理错误代码,导致在某些特定网络环境下程序崩溃。 这个经历强调了正确使用 nfapi.dll 接口的重要性,以及细致的错误处理对程序稳定性的关键作用。 我们最终通过添加更完善的错误处理机制,确保了工具的稳定运行。

因此,nfapi.dll 本身并不直接影响用户的电脑使用,它的作用体现在它所提供的接口上。 如果你的电脑出现问题,怀疑与 nfapi.dll 有关,更准确地说,你应该关注的是哪些程序正在使用它,以及这些程序是否正常工作。 通常情况下,你不必直接与 nfapi.dll 打交道,除非你是开发网络相关的程序。 如果遇到问题,建议检查系统日志,查看是否有相关的错误信息,并尝试更新或卸载可疑的软件。 更进一步的排查,可能需要借助专业的系统分析工具。

以上就是nfapi.dll是什么的详细内容,更多请关注php中文网其它相关文章!

.dll文件大全
.dll文件大全

.dll文件缺失怎么办?.dll文件在哪下载?不用担心,这里为大家提供了所有的.dll文件下载,无论用户丢失的是什么.dll文件,在这里都能找到。用户保存后,在网盘搜索dll文件全称即可查找下载!

下载
相关标签:
来源:php中文网
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n
最新问题
开源免费商场系统广告
热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板
关于我们 免责申明 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送
PHP中文网APP
随时随地碎片化学习
PHP中文网抖音号
发现有趣的

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号